
As I was going through the photos and specs, I realized this watch is right in my strike zone. Size, color, strap—check, check, check. It’s a really clean execution, and pairing that with a yellow gold case just works. Then I got to the price—$32,800—which feels a bit high and puts it in a competitive range. That said, it’s a very clean, elegant watch, and it’s nice to see the brand bring yellow gold into the main collection. It’s certainly one of my favorite Grand Seiko releases in recent memory.
